PROJECT OVERVIEW

Name and Creator: AIROX: 145 PSI Cordless Dual-Compressor. Just 9.9 lb by Magpie Tech.

What It Is: AIROX is a highly portable, battery powered air compressor featuring a built in aluminum air tank. It utilizes a dual motor setup to deliver professional grade air pressure and rapid recovery speeds without the need for a wall outlet.


KEY FEATURES

  • Extreme Portability: At just 9.9 lbs (4.5kg) and featuring an ultra compact form factor, the unit easily slides into tight gaps, car trunks, or underneath workbenches, giving you an infinite working radius on remote job sites.

  • Dual Motor System: Two 35 L/min pumps work in parallel to deliver 2.5 CFM, allowing the tank to reach 100 PSI in just 9.6 seconds. During continuous use, it recovers to full pressure in a blistering 6.35 seconds.

  • High Pressure Performance: The compressor delivers a maximum of 145 PSI, giving it enough sustained power to fire up to 200 nails per minute without pressure drops.

  • Oil Free Operation: The advanced oil-less mechanism requires absolutely no maintenance and ensures 100 percent clean air output, which is highly critical for painting and airbrushing applications.

  • Versatile Battery Platform: The system runs on a 21V 5,000mAh battery that can provide up to 5 hours of runtime depending on the task. Best of all, the platform is fully compatible with standard Makita 18V batteries, meaning you can use your existing power tool batteries right out of the box.

  • Low Noise Design: Compared to traditional clunky compressors, AIROX runs at a much quieter 85 decibels, significantly reducing operational noise and vibration in enclosed spaces.

  • Precision and Safety: It features exact 1 PSI step controls, a digital pressure sensor that triggers auto shutdown if limits are exceeded, and a physical fail safe valve for total peace of mind.
